You didn’t come by bus, did you? ______, I came ______ a taxi.

A. No, by B. No, in

C. Yes, by D. Yes, in

B

【解析】

试题解析:句意:-你没坐公共汽车来,是吗?-是的,我坐出租车来的。在回答反义疑问句时,无论问题的提法如何,如果事实是肯定的,就用yes,事实是否定的,就要用no。因为事实是乘坐出租车来的而非公共汽车,所以要用 No;而by后面加交通工具不加冠词,所以用in。故选B。

考点:考查反义疑问句的回答及介词的用法
